We provide IT Staff Augmentation Services!

Sr. Etl Informatica Consultant Resume

0/5 (Submit Your Rating)

Boston, MA

SUMMARY

  • Over 8+ years of experience with Database Analysis, System design, Application Development, Testing support and Production support for Data Warehousing which involves ETL, Reporting and Data modeling experience. Expertise in development of Data warehousing solutions using Informatica Power Center 9.x/8.x
  • Experience in data modeling, data warehouse, and Ralph Kimball models with Star/Snowflake Schema Designs with analysis - definition, database design, testing, and implementation and Quality process.
  • Professional Experience in ETL Architecture using Informatica Power Center, 7.x/8.x/9.x
  • Experience in design and implementation using ETL tools like Informatica (Power Center) Designer, Repository Manager and Workflow / Server Manager. Experience working in Oracle 9i/10g/11g with database objects like triggers, stored procedures, functions, packages, views, indexes.
  • Strong experience in designing and developing business intelligence solutions in Data warehouse/Decision Support Systems using ETL tools Informatica Power Center 9.1/8.6.1/8.1/7.1/6.2/6.1 , OLTP, OLAP.
  • Experience in Oracle 11i/10g/9i/8i/7.x, SQL*Plus, SQL*Loader, IBM DB2 8.0/7.0, MS SQL Server 2000/2005/2008.
  • Understanding & working knowledge of Informatica CDC (Change Data Capture) Implementation.
  • Data modeling experience using Star Schema/Snowflake modeling, OLAP/ROLAP tools, Fact and Dimensions tables, Physical and logical data modeling and Oracle Designer.
  • Experience with reading from Mainframe datasets and Cobol Sources using Informatica Power Exchange.
  • Experience in Installation, Configuration, and Administration of Informatica Power Center 9.x/8.x/7.x/6.x, Power exchange 8.1 and Power Mart 5.x/6.x Client, Server.
  • Extensively worked on Data Warehouse Administrative Console (DAC).
  • Experience in OBIEE10x / Siebel Analytics including Designing and Configuring Repository, Creating/managing Dashboards, Answers, and Interactive dashboards.
  • Extracted data from various sources like Oracle, DB2, Flat file, SQL SERVER, XML files, Teradata and loaded into Oracle database. Also worked as PL/SQL developer
  • Experience in data integration of various data sources from Databases like MS Access, Oracle, SQL Server and formats like flat-files, CSV files, COBOL and XML files. Extensive experience in Performance Tuning -Identified and fixed bottlenecks and tuned the complex Informatica mappings for better Performance.
  • Experience in developing OBIEE Repository at three layers (Physical, Business model and Presentation Layers), Implemented Dimensional Hierarchies, Level based Measures, Aggregations, Cache Management.
  • Experience in Repository Configuration, creating Transformations and Mappings using Informatica Designer and processing tasks using Workflow Manager to move data from multiple sources into targets.
  • Extensively worked on both Windows (Batch and Power shell) and Unix Scripting.
  • Experience in creation and customization of ETL extracts and load process using Informatica.
  • Experience in Business Objects, Crystal Reports specifications document for monitoring performance of Business Objects using BAC Monitoring System.
  • Experience in Performance tuning of Informatica (sources, mappings, targets and sessions) and tuning the SQL queries.
  • Worked on data migration of Informatica Mappings, Sessions, and Workflows to Data Integrator.
  • Excellent communication and interpersonal skills, ability to learn quickly, good analytical reasoning and high adaptability to new technologies and tools.
  • Innovative team player possessing good communication & presentation skills and support to onshore and offshore clients.

TECHNICAL SKILLS

Data Warehousing/ETL Tools: Informatica PowerCenter 9.x/8.x/7.x (Mapping Designer, Mapplet, Transformation, Sessions, Workflow Manager-Workflow, Task, Commands, Worklet, Transactional Control, Constraint Based Loading, SCD I, II, Web Services and XML transformations), PowerExchange, BODI, Metadata, Informatica Data Quality (IDQ) 7.3, Informatica Datamart

Databases: Oracle 11g/10g/9i, MS SQL Server 2008/2005, DB2, Sybase, Teradata, MS Access 7.0/2000, SQL Server (DTS/SSIS/SSRS)

Reporting Tools: OBIEE 10g/11g, Cognos

Tools: MS Office 2010,07 Professional, SQL*Plus 3.3/8.0, TOAD, Server Management Studio Express, Microsoft Visio, Putty, Text Pad, .vsd files, .csv files, Erwin, ER Model, Siebel, Salesforce Integration, DAC,RPD, SAP

Programming Languages: Unix Shell Scripting and Perl Scripting, Batch Scripting, VB.NET 05/08, XML, HTML, C, C++, UML (Rational Rose), Java, Oracle PL/SQL (Stored Procedures, triggers, Indexes).

Environment: Windows 98/2000/2003/ XP/NT and Windows NT, UNIX, SOLARIS.

Data Modeling: Star Schema and Snow-Flake Modeling, Fact and Dimensions Tables, Physical and Logical Data Modeling, ER Studio, Erwin 4.5/4.2/3.5/3. x,Oracle Designer/2000.

PROFESSIONAL EXPERIENCE

Confidential, Boston, MA

Sr. ETL Informatica Consultant

Responsibilities:

  • Designed and Developed Mappings, sessions and workflows in Informatica.
  • Used Informatica and the Data Warehouse Administration Console (DAC) to configure ETL metadata and run an execution plan to load Oracle E-Business Suite (EBS) data into the OBAW.
  • Designed and developed Informatica Mappings to load data from Source systems to ODS and then to Data Mart.
  • Customized SDE and SIL mappings using Informatica PowerCenter Designer in order to add new columns to the Dimension/Fact table in Oracle Business Analytics Warehouse from Oracle EBS Source.
  • Designed the Data model and Load strategy to get data from different systems and use it for the Online Registration database.
  • Prepared the Technical Specs, Reverse Engineered Logical designs using Erwin, Flow diagrams and Timeline sheets to facilitate development of Informatica Flows.
  • Implemented Star Schema for denormalizing data for faster data retrieval for Online Systems.
  • Extracted, transformed data from various sources such as Flat files, Oracle 11g and transferred data to the target data warehouse Oracle 11g and XLS files.
  • Explore prebuilt ETL metadata, including Informatica workflows and mappings and DAC metadata.
  • Designed and developed Informatica Mapping for data load and data cleansing.
  • Integrated the developed Data Warehouse into OBIEE administration tool for reporting purpose.
  • Responsible for Pre and Post migration planning for optimizing Data load performance capacity planning and user support.
  • Involved in building the Physical, Business and Presentation Layer through OBIEE Administration tool.
  • Performed migration of mappings and workflows from Development to Test and to Production Servers.
  • Partitioned sources and used persistent cache for Lookup’s to improve session performance.
  • Worked closely with QA team during the testing phase and fixed bugs that were reported.
  • Worked with Data / Data Warehouse Architect on logical and physical model designs.
  • Performed impact analysis for systems and database modifications.

Environment: Informatica Power Center 9.5/9.1/8.6.1 , Oracle 11g/10g, OBIEE 10g, SQL Server, XML, Flat Files, Toad, DAC 10g/11g (Data Warehouse Administration Console), Shell Scripting.

Confidential, Addison, IL

Sr. ETL/Informatica Developer

Responsibilities:

  • Designed the Data model and Load strategy to get data from different systems and use it for the Online Registration database.
  • Prepared the Technical Specs, Reverse Engineered Logical designs using Erwin, Flow diagrams and Timeline sheets to facilitate development of Informatica Flows.
  • Extensive experience in ETL development and maintenance using Oracle SQL, PL/SQL and written Store procedure for the Data Dimensions table to insert 10 years’ worth of data and also used the Informatica Store Procedure Transformation to update the columns in the same table
  • Implemented Star Schema for De-normalizing data for faster data retrieval for Online Systems.
  • Developed Procedures and Functions in PL/SQL for Data ETL.
  • Designed and Developed Mappings, sessions and workflows in Informatica.
  • Extracted, transformed data from various sources such as Flat files, Oracle 11g and transferred data to the target data warehouse Oracle 11g and Flat files.
  • Customized Project, HR, Procurement and Finance inbuilt mappings.
  • Involved in installation and configuration of Informatica and DAC.
  • Designed and Deployed UNIX Shell Scripts.
  • Integrated the developed Data Warehouse into OBIEE administration tool for reporting purpose.
  • Used Conversion process for VSAM to ASCII source files usingInformaticaPowerExchange.
  • Performed metadata validation, reconciliation and appropriate error handling in ETL processes.
  • Responsible for Pre and Post migration planning for optimizing Data load performance, capacity planning and user support.
  • Performed migration of mappings and workflows from Development to Test and to Production Servers.
  • Involved in creating STAR Schema for OLAP cubes.
  • Involved in building the Physical, Business and Presentation Layer through OBIEE Administration tool.
  • Designed, developed and improved complex ETL structures to extract transform and load data from multiple data sources into data warehouse and other databases based on business requirements.
  • Partitioned sources and used persistent cache for Lookup’s to improve session performance
  • Worked closely with QA team during the testing phase and fixed bugs that were reported.
  • Worked with Data / Data Warehouse Architect on logical and physical model designs.
  • Involved in developing of stored procedure for Change Data Capture (CDC), Auditing etc.
  • Monitored Incremental and Full load of Data through Data Warehouse Administration Console (DAC) and Informatica Workflow Monitor.
  • Extracted data from Sales department to flat files and load the data to the target database.

Environment: Informatica Power Center 9.1/8.6.1, Power Exchange8.1.1, Oracle 11g/10g, OBIEE, DAC, SQL Server, Teradata, XML, Flat Files, Toad, Sql Developer, Shell Scripting.

Confidential - Bloomington, IL

ETL/Informatica Developer

Responsibilities:

  • Developed ETL for Data Extraction, Data Mapping and Data Conversion using Informatica Power Center 8.6.0
  • Informatica Power Center is used to extract the base tables in the data warehouse and the source databases include Oracle, Flat files and SQL Server.
  • Extensive BI and Data warehousing experience using Siebel Analytics 7.x/OBIEE and Informatica 9.x/8.x/7.x/6.x.
  • Setup the batches, configured the sessions and scheduled the loads as per requirement using UNIX scripts.
  • Worked on Informatica Data Quality (IDQ) to resolve customers address related issues.
  • Worked onPowerExchangefor change data capture (CDC).
  • Extensively worked in fixing poorly designed mappings and developed schedules to automate the Informatica workflows
  • Responsible for the Dimensional Data Modeling and populating the business rules using mappings into the Repository for Meta Data management.
  • Used Informatica and the Data Warehouse Administration Console (DAC) to configure
  • Developed oracle PL/SQL, DDLs, and Stored Procedures and worked on performance and fine Tuning of SQL & PL/SQL stored procedures. Involved in creation of multiple data integration schemas for tuning and purging of data
  • Troubleshooting and debugging of defects and production issues in the areas of SQL, Informatica and OBIEE 11g/10g.
  • Involved in SQL tuning while creation of various different sql procedures.
  • Developed Informatica mappings using transformations like Lookup, Stored Procedure, Filter, Expression, and Aggregator.
  • Involved in Performance Tuning at various levels including Target, Source, Mapping and Session for large data files.
  • Customized Informatica and DAC metadata.
  • Created test plans and did unit testing for the Informatica mappings and stored procedures
  • Extensively involved in writing ETL Specs for Development and conversion projects.
  • Extensively used PVCS and Serena.
  • Worked on various data issues in Production environment.
  • Uploaded data from operational source system (Oracle 8i) toTeradata.
  • Data is Staged, integrated, Validated and finally loaded the data into Teradata Warehouse using Informatica.
  • Recommended temporary fixes and workarounds for production issues and also proposed permanent fixes.
  • Involved in Production Scheduling to setup jobs in order and provided 24x7 production support.

Environment: Informatica Power Center 8.6.1, Oracle 10g/9i, OBIEE, DAC, SQL, PL/SQL, Teradata, TOAD, SQL*Plus, Windows 2000, SQL Server, UNIX, Cognos.

Confidential, Boston, MA

ETL/Informatica Developer

Responsibilities:

  • Interacting with business representatives for requirement analysis and to define business and functional specifications.
  • Designing and building data marts for Disability, Life, Accident, and underwriting divisions.
  • Loading Data to the Interface tables from multiple data sources such as SQL server, Text files and Excel Spreadsheets using SQL Loader, Informatica and ODBC connections.
  • Creating necessary repositories to handle the metadata in the ETL process.
  • Designing the target warehouse using Star Schema.
  • Even involved in some tasks like Development and setting up the new environments and Generating Microsoft Sql server Reports (SSIS).
  • Involved in installation and configuration of Informatica and DAC.
  • Designing and introducing new FACT or Dimension Tables to the existing Model and deciding the granularity of Fact Tables.
  • Helped the team in analyzing the data to be able to identify the data quality issues.
  • Installed and configured Informatica Power Center and Server 8.6.
  • Designing different regional data marts and loaded subset of warehouse data.
  • Writing Unix Shell Scripts to load data from different sources.
  • Implementing Aggregate, Filter, Join, and Expression, Lookup, Sequence generator and Update Strategy transformations.
  • Designed and developed transformation rules (business rules) to generate consolidated (fact/summary) data using Informatica ETL (Power center) tool.
  • Implementing Variables and Parameters in Transformations to calculate billing data in billing Domain.
  • Used Java Transformations to invoke web services and Java Servlets.
  • Tuning performance of Informatica session for large data files by increasing block size, data cache size, sequence buffer length and target based commit interval.
  • Simplified the data flow by using a Router transformation to check multiple conditions at the same time.
  • Creating sessions, sequential and concurrent batches for proper execution of mappings using workflow manager.
  • Optimizing Query Performance, Session Performance and Reliability.
  • Designing Database schemas using Erwin Design Tool.
  • Using Informatica Designer designed and developed Source Entities and Target warehouse Entity for Oracle.
  • Involving in versioning the whole process and retiring the old records using the built-in’s DD UPDATE, DD DELETE, and DD INSERT.
  • Developing Mapplets using corresponding Source, Targets and Transformations.
  • Testing all the applications and transport the data to target Warehouse Oracle tables on the server, Schedule and Run Extraction and Load process and monitor sessions by using Informatica Workflow Manager.

Environment: Informatica 8.6/8.1, Oracle 9i (TOAD), OBIEE, DAC, MS SQL SERVER 2005, MS SQL Reporting Services (SSIS), MS ACCESS, MS EXCEL 2007(PIVOT tables), Autosys.

Confidential, NM

Informatica Developer

Responsibilities:

  • Involved in data design and modeling by specifying the physical infrastructure, system study, design, and development by applying Ralph Kimball methodology of dimensional modeling and using Erwin.
  • Imported various Application Sources, created Targets and Transformations using Informatica Power Center Designer (Source analyzer, Warehouse developer, Transformation developer, Mapplet designer, and Mapping designer).
  • Actively involved in gathering requirements from the end users.
  • Used ETL (Informatica) to load data from sources like Oracle database and Flat Files.
  • Designed and developed Informatica Mappings and Sessions based on business user requirements and business rules to load data from source flat files and RDBMS tables to target tables..
  • Worked with various transformations to solve the Slowly Changing Dimensional Problems using Informatica Power Center
  • Developed and scheduled Workflows using task developer, worklet designer, and workflow designer in Workflow manager and monitored the results in Workflow monitor.
  • Did performance tuning at source, transformation, target, and workflow levels.
  • Used PMCMD, and UNIX shell scripts for workflow automation.
  • Involved in creating and management of global and local repositories and assigning permissions using
  • Repository Manager. Also migrated repositories between development, testing and production systems.
  • Worked with Source Analyzer, Warehouse Designer, Transformation designer, Mapping designer and Workflow Manager.
  • Extensively used Stored Procedures, Functions and PL/ SQL Programming.
  • Extensively used Normalizer transformation while loading the data from the COBOL copybooks to the staging area.
  • Used transformations such as the source qualifier, normalizer, aggregators, connected & unconnected lookups, filters, sorter, stored procedures, router & sequence generator.
  • Checked and tuned the performance of application.
  • Developed data Mappings between source systems and warehouse components.
  • Created and defined DDL’s for the tables at staging area.
  • Responsible for creating shared and reusable objects in Informatica shared folder and update the objects with the new requirements and changes.
  • Analyzed systems, met with end users and business units, in order to define and meet the requirements.
  • Automated mappings to run using UNIX shell scripts, which included Pre and Post-session jobs.
  • Documented user requirements, translated requirements into system solutions and develop implementation plan and schedule.
  • Migration between Development, Test and Production Repositories.
  • Supported the Quality Assurance team in testing and validating the Informatica workflows.
  • Did unit testing and development testing at ETL level in my mappings.
  • Installed and configured Informatica Tools on client machine on Windows NT environment.
  • Used Informatica Power Analyzer and Informatica Analytics for developing Dashboards, Alerts, Reports,
  • Indicators and Adhoc Query Reporting.
  • Training the users how to access and run the jobs Using Informatica workflow Manager

Environment: Informatica Power Center 8.1/7.1.3, Oracle 10g, Toad 7.5, Erwin, SQL, PL/SQL, SQL plus, MS SQL Server 2005, UNIX.

Confidential, Minneapolis, MN

Informatica Developer

Responsibilities:

  • Interacted with different teams across different line of business on standardization and protocols to be followed when integrating data across different systems.
  • Involved in designing the Data Warehouse structure and all its components like Dimensions, Facts, and Aggregations etc. by backtracking from Reports Specifications.
  • Created Technical Specifications for source to target mapping of data to implement the business rules and logic
  • Wrote complex SQL scripts to avoid Informatica Joiners and Look-ups to improve the performance as the volume of the data was heavy
  • Designed the complex mappings, used Aggregator, Filter, Router, and Expression, Connected and Unconnected lookup, Sorter, Normalizer, Joiner transformations and Update Strategy transformation
  • Created mappings to extract and de-normalize(flatten) data from XML(XSD) files using multiple joiners with Power Center
  • Implemented slowly changing dimension (SCD) Type 1 and Type 2 mappings for changed data capture.
  • Developed and scheduled Workflows using Workflow designer in Workflow Manager and monitored the results in Workflow monitor Worked with many existing Mappings to produce correct output.
  • Created events and tasks in the work flows using workflow manager.
  • Used shell scripts to load data from flat files to Oracle tables using Informatica and also to cleanse data
  • Tried to implement best practices following proper naming convention, directory structure, access mechanism, reusability of code etc.
  • Involved in Performance Tuning of sources, targets, mappings, transformations and sessions to optimize session performance
  • Performed the Unit Testing which validate the data is mapped correctly which provides a qualitative check of overall data flow up and deposited correctly in Target Tables

Environment: Informatica Power Center 7.1, Toad, Power Exchange 5.1, Oracle10g, PL/SQL, SQL Server.

We'd love your feedback!